3. Fees

Car accident lawyers are incredibly helpful in assisting clients navigate the legal system to settle disputes and obtain compensation for their losses and injuries. They have the expertise and experience to help clients create strong cases to accurately calculate damages and recover losses that include tangible expenses like medical expenses, lost wages and property damage, and intangible expenses like pain and suffering, and emotional stress. They know the tactics that insurance companies employ to cut settlements and also how to fight them.

These resources and skills are not free, and clients must be aware of the fees their lawyer will charge. The majority of personal injury attorneys work on a basis of contingency fees which means that they only receive payment when they are successful in a client's case. This can range from 25 to 40 percent of the total award or settlement. These fees are influenced by a variety of variables, including the lawyer's reputation and experience and the complexity of a case, and the level required of representation.

Some lawyers will also charge a flat fee for their services, but this type of arrangement is usually reserved for simpler cases when the only work required is the drafting and response to an order letter. The lawyer will explain the fee structure during the initial consultation.

Car accidents are among the most common causes of serious injuries and deaths in the United States each year. They typically occur because of driver negligence which is defined as the failure to exercise the same level of care that a reasonably prudent person would exercise in similar situations. This includes not obeying traffic laws, driving under the impaired by alcohol or drugs and speeding.

You could also have to take action against the manufacturer of the vehicle, or any component that is defective If you are unable to get compensation from the insurance company of the party at fault. This could lead to additional compensation, like punitive damages.
